Early day motion tabled by primary sponsor Jeffrey M Donaldson (Democratic Unionist Party), on Thursday, 5 February 2009, in the House of Commons. It is signed by 32 members in total.
PRESBYTERIAN MUTUAL SOCIETY
That this House notes with concern the plight of investors in the Presbyterian Mutual Society in Northern Ireland; recognises that the society is now in administration due in the main part to the withdrawal of investments brought about by the introduction of a guarantee for the UK banking sector;further notes that the Government has provided assistance to UK investors in overseas banks; and calls on the Prime Minister and the Chancellor of the Exchequer to extend that guarantee to provident and mutual societies such as the Presbyterian Mutual Society.
